@Nonnull
private static DexFile loadClassPathEntry(Iterable<String> classPathDirs, String bootClassPathEntry) {
for (String classPathDir: classPathDirs) {
File rawEntry = new File(bootClassPathEntry);
// strip off the path - we only care about the filename
String entryName = rawEntry.getName();
int extIndex = entryName.lastIndexOf(".");
String baseEntryName;
if (extIndex == -1) {
baseEntryName = entryName;
} else {
baseEntryName = entryName.substring(0, extIndex);
}
for (String ext: new String[]{"", ".odex", ".jar", ".apk", ".zip"}) {
File file = new File(classPathDir, baseEntryName + ext);
if (file.exists()) {
if (!file.canRead()) {
System.err.println(String.format(
"warning: cannot open %s for reading. Will continue looking.", file.getPath()));
} else {
try {
return DexFileFactory.loadDexFile(file);
} catch (DexFileFactory.NoClassesDexException ex) {
// ignore and continue
} catch (Exception ex) {
throw ExceptionWithContext.withContext(ex,
"Error while reading boot class path entry \"%s\"", bootClassPathEntry);
}
}
}
}
}
throw new ExceptionWithContext("Cannot locate boot class path file %s", bootClassPathEntry);
}
